As a Project Support Officer, you will be part of a team supporting Native Title work that has real impact for Aboriginal people and communities. It’s about helping keep projects on track, pulling together research, keeping records and information up to date, and preparing clear, easy‑to‑understand briefings so everyone can make informed decisions. You’ll stay connected with people across the team and our partners, sharing updates and helping things run smoothly day to day.

 

Some days will be busy, with different priorities and perspectives to balance. We work through this by staying organised, building respectful relationships, and making sure everything we do aligns with Native Title legislation. The focus is on supporting outcomes that are culturally appropriate and delivered in a thoughtful, coordinated way.

The Department of Planning, Housing and Infrastructure (DPHI) improves the liveability and prosperity of NSW. To achieve this, we: create vibrant, productive spaces and precincts; manage lands, assets and property effectively and deliver affordable and diverse housing. We strive to be a high-performing, world-class public service organisation that celebrates and reflects the full diversity of the community we serve and builds the cultural capability of our department to improve outcomes with and for Aboriginal people, communities and entities.
